Are you attempting it solo? that may be part of why you're timing out, but don't get discouraged, it's still possible - just a lot, lot harder.

When i beat Dalama, i did it with a group of 4. All three of us had at least 400 def, while one guy had high 300's and kept getting creamed, so i'd definitely recomended at least 400 defense. Secondly, you can NOT get intimidated by it! Think of it this way: Sure, he's a giant snake monster, but he's only got like 5 attacks he can hit you with! He's not SO Scary! Just Superman dive the laser beam and you're golden! I also suggest "Mounting" him as much as you can, by which i mean stunning him. He's gets stunned extremely easily, and well-placed aerial attacks is the way to get it done. any time he gets stunned, he just lays down on the ground practically begging for you to wail on his head. Heck, you can even just attack his neck/body if you're too far away from his head, he's so big you can hit him from anywhere. Also, neat trick i found- you know that pillar he wraps himself around where you can climb up his back? While everyone else is doing that, you can go below him. There's a pool of water that randomly does a bit of heat damage to you, but hardly much. To the left wrapped around said pillar, you can hit his mid/lower body. While it may not look like the hits are connecting, you'll clearly be able to see blood when you hit his body from down there, and he cannot hit you with anything aside from Meteors if they decided to target you down there, which will rarely happen in multiplayer. Easy way to rack up crazy damage, just be careful since it's a small area and other people might know if it too!
